What is 3D Printing?
In simple terms, 3D printing is a process of creating three-dimensional objects by building up successive layers of material. The material used can vary, but the most common are plastics, metals and ceramics. The printer reads a digital 3D model and produces a physical object layer by layer.
Advantages of 3D Printing
- Speed and Efficiency: 3D printing is much faster than traditional manufacturing methods, such as injection molding or CNC machining.
- Customization: 3D printing allows for the creation of unique, custom and one-off products, without the need for specialized tooling.
- Reduced Waste: 3D printing generates significantly less waste compared to traditional manufacturing methods.
- Cost-Effective: 3D printing can be more cost-effective for small-batch or one-off production runs.
- Improved Design: 3D printing allows for the creation of complex designs, which can lead to the development of better and more innovative products.
Applications of 3D Printing
- Healthcare: 3D printing is being used in the medical industry to create prosthetics, implants and surgical tools.
- Aerospace: 3D printing is used in the aerospace industry to create lighter, stronger and more efficient components.
- Automotive: 3D printing is used in the automotive industry to create prototypes, tooling and small-batch production runs.
- Consumer Products: 3D printing is used in the consumer goods industry to create unique and custom products, such as phone cases and jewelry.
